Transaction 5abbc7065add74d11f67631cf8bb3a5ca1f127a729a220eb16c98f00688b2115
1 Input
1 Output
-
5abbc7065add74d11f67631cf8bb3a5ca1f127a729a220eb16c98f00688b2115:0
- value
- 110850
- script pubkey
- OP_0 OP_PUSHBYTES_20 abe73c9d2d887438bc09dc6b985ff18249ec780e
- address
- bc1q40nne8fd3p6r30qfm34eshl3sfy7c7qwt0j0ed